Today, the use of renewable energy sources is increasing day by day. The essential advantages of wind energy are that it is clean, low costly, and unlimited. The efficiency of wind power plants is an important issue. In this paper, the wind energy potential of provinces of the Marmara region in Turkey was evaluated by multi-criteria decision-making (MCDM) methods. TOPSIS and PROMETHEE methods were used for analysis. The weights of the criteria determined for the decision model were taken equally. According to the analysis results, Balikesir and Çanakkale were determined as priority provinces in wind power plant potential, while Kocaeli and Sakarya were ranked last. Spearman's Correlation Coefficient determined the level and direction of the relationship between the rankings obtained from TOPSIS and the PROMETHEE method. It was concluded that the relationship between the obtained value of "0.636"and the rankings obtained from the methods was a "positive"and "moderate"relationship. In this context, it has been verified that two methods with different algorithm steps support each other. © 2021 IEEE.
